If ships are player-crafted (which they should be, like most items in the game), then yeah, the first day the expansion comes out, they will surely cost A LOT, because only a few people will be able to make them...and a few crazy people will pay it. Then, as more and more people improve in ship-building rank, the price will start going lower and lower. It's just supply and demand. So, even though most people will not be able to afford a ship on the first day, soon enough the prices will go down.
